Core Responsibilities:
CSN is seeking applications for part-time instructors to teach History courses. The courses will be introductory level courses unless there is a specific need for instructors to teach other program courses. The greater need is for on ground instructors than online, but online courses are a possibility. Job responsibilities also include developing syllabi and course materials as well as evaluation of mastery of skills and competencies as required by course outcomes. Successful candidates are expected to provide an excellent teaching experience, engage in student advisement and participate in assessment of general education, program and course outcomes.

Required Qualifications
- Master's degree (Ph.D. preferred) from a regionally accredited college or university with at least 18 graduate credits in the subject being taught, also from a regionally accredited college or university.
Salary Information
$925.00 per lecture credit hour. Credits will vary by semester.
